摘要
Body temperature is maintained by effective thermoregulation, which balances the process of heat production and heat loss. Heat balance includes heat production of energy and heat loss. Skin moisture/water evaporation from the body plays an important role in heat transfer, especially during exercising or in hot conditions. The regional skin evaporation could significantly affect the heat release of the body localized, the pattern of skin temperature distribution, and in terms influence the thermoregulation. The distribution sweat evaporation and skin temperature could also be applied as a means for managing the body thermoregulation. This review systematically investigates the thermoregulation of human body, local skin evaporation and skin temperature distribution, to highlight its application in the development of sportswear and prevention of heat disorder in hot condition.
